Does the Xantrex battery monitor show charge amps whether on shore battery charger or engine alternator? Should it show the sum of charger and alternator current when both are active?
The boat has 6 Gp 31 AGM, 100 AH, 12 Volt house batteries and 1 GP 31 AGM 12 volt engine battery. When running off shore power and battery charger, the Xantrex shows 50 amps (battery charge at 85%) while charging. This current level matched the level shown in the battery charger output display.
With battery charger off, and running the engine at 2000 RPM, the Xantrex only shows the drain, not the net of charge and drain current. I expected the Xantrex to show 50 amps since the battery charge state was 85%.
Does this mean that either the regulator or alternator are not properly functioning? It is a Balmar 100 amp alternator and Max Charge regulator.

Post by hoppy on Nov 17, 2018 0:11:41 GMT
It all depends on how the boat is wired up. The difference you see could be caused by the alternator cable bypassing the shunt for the Xantrex and going directly to the battery. For diagnosing the electrics, I found a clip on multimeter totally invaluable.

Post by cabrillojim on Nov 17, 2018 1:00:02 GMT
I will take a look. The wiring diagram shows the alternator positive connected to the engine battery / house battery splitter. I assume the negative is to a common ground. I assume that if that connection is downstream from the shunt, then the Xantrex will not see the current, correct? I need to look at the wiring diagrams and the actual wiring. Thx...Jim

Post by cabrillojim on Nov 18, 2018 0:08:25 GMT
It was a simple fix. The alternator was not outputting any current. One wire between the alternator and the regulator was disconnected. It was the regulator on / off circuit. Reconnected it, and voila! Stuff works. The tachometer functions properly, and the Xantex show current into the batteries from alternator or battery charger.
